
Bandits & GreenState to Host Free Day to Celebrate "Best Minor League Ballpark" Award
May 5, 2025 - Midwest League (MWL)
Quad Cities River Bandits News Release
Davenport, Iowa - In celebration of Modern Woodmen Park again being recognized as the nation's "Best Minor League Ballpark" in USA Today 10Best's 2025 Readers' Choice Awards, the River Bandits and GreenState Credit Union today announced that admission to the game on Tuesday, May 13, will be free to everyone. In addition, there will be a free pennant giveaway for the first 500 guests, courtesy of Pepsi of Davenport, and the Bandits will be offering $2 hot dogs and sodas all night long.
Enhancing the fun even more, May 13 will also be "Opening May," the first game of the team's first homestand in May, which means all of the amusements rides, including the Ferris wheel, double-decker carousel, Wind-Up, DoublePlay, gyroscope and Froghopper, will all be open for the first time this year.
"All of us in the River Bandits family are so grateful to this great community for supporting our team and making Modern Woodmen Park- again- America's Best Minor League Ballpark that we wanted to say thank you by letting everyone in for free," said River Bandits owner Dave Heller. "To partner with Vic Israni and all of our good friends at GreenState Credit Union, who, like us, are all about giving back makes it even more special. Quad Cities has the best people anywhere and what better way to say thank you to this great community than to invite everyone to enjoy a River Bandits game for free."
Fans can join in on the fun by picking up their free tickets for the 6:30 p.m. game against the Dayton Dragons at the Modern Woodmen Park box office during regular business hours (Monday through Friday, 9: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m.).
"We are excited to partner with the River Bandits for this event," said GreenState CEO Vic Israni. "We love to support local community traditions and there is nothing more traditional than a night at the ballpark with friends and family. We hope to pack the park!"
This year's marks Modern Woodmen Park's third-straight USA Today 10Best's Readers' Choice Award after the ballpark earned the distinction in 2024 and in the publication's inaugural ranking in 2014. The accolade is just the latest for the historic venue which, since the Quad Cities franchise was purchased by Main Street Baseball in 2007, has been named one of the nation's best by the likes of Bleacher Report, Ballpark Digest, and Parade Magazine.
